Volker Rümelin acc3b63e1b paaudio: try to drain the recording stream
There is no guarantee a single call to pa_stream_peek every
timer_period microseconds can read a recording stream faster
than the data gets produced at the source. Let qpa_read try to
drain the recording stream.

To reproduce the problem:

Start qemu with -audiodev pa,id=audio0,in.mixing-engine=off

On the host connect the qemu recording stream to the monitor of
a hardware output device. While the problem can also be seen
with a hardware input device, it's obvious with the monitor of
a hardware output device.

In the guest start audio recording with audacity and notice the
slow recording data rate.
